    A symplectic Renner monoid is a non-Abelian submonoid of a rook monoid. The authors study conjugacy classes of the symplectic Renner monoid \(\mathcal R\), and find the following results. Each element in \(\mathcal R\) is a join of strictly disjoint cycles and strings. There is an explicit one-to-one correspondence between conjugacy classes and symplectic partitions. A formula for calculating the number of conjugacy classes is obtained. An explicit formula for computing the number of elements in each conjugacy class is given. A relationship between conjugacy classes and Munn conjugacy classes is described.
